def _has_any_error_handlers(self) -> bool:
if self.on_error is not None:
return True
parent = self.parent
if parent is not None:
# Check if the on_error is overridden
if parent.__class__.on_error is not Group.on_error:
return True
if parent.parent is not None:
parent_cls = parent.parent.__class__
if parent_cls.on_error is not Group.on_error:
return True
return False
